Hand Photo Database
A large-scale, high-resolution dataset of contactless hand photos collected under controlled studio conditions (25 cm / 40 cm distances), including both dry and wet hand conditions. Each volunteer contributed 12 images (6 per hand), enabling extraction of finger photos (5 per hand) and palm photos. Designed to support multibiometric research on RGB-only smartphone-based authentication, it is — to our knowledge — the largest publicly described dataset enabling joint minutiae-based recognition of fingers and palm.
⚠️ Note: Due to ethical and privacy restrictions, the full dataset cannot be shared publicly. A subset may be released pending participant re-consent. Researchers interested in reproducibility or collaboration are welcome to contact me for technical guidance.
